Commercial Ceiling Fan Repair in Alpharetta, GA
Commercial ceiling fan repair services address issues with ceiling fans installed in business and commercial properties, including offices, retail spaces, and warehouses. These services typically cover repairs for malfunctioning fans, such as wobbling, noisy operation, broken blades, electrical problems, or motor failures. Property owners often seek these repairs to restore proper airflow, improve energy efficiency, and maintain a comfortable environment for employees and customers. Before requesting repair services, it’s helpful for property owners to understand the specific issues with the fan, the type and model of the fan, and whether any previous repairs or modifications have been made.
The scope of commercial ceiling fan repair projects can vary from simple blade replacements to more complex motor or wiring repairs. Property owners should consider whether the fan is still under warranty, if the repair will restore the fan’s full functionality, and whether replacement parts are readily available. Clarifying these details can ensure the repair process is efficient and effective. Understanding the age and condition of the fan, as well as any safety concerns, can also help determine if repair is the best option or if a replacement might be more suitable.

Commercial Ceiling Fan Repair Questions
What are common signs of a faulty commercial ceiling fan? Unusual noises, wobbling, inconsistent speeds, or failure to operate are typical indicators of issues needing repair.
Can a commercial ceiling fan be repaired if it stops working? Yes, many problems such as wiring issues, motor faults, or control problems can often be fixed without replacing the entire fan.
What types of commercial ceiling fans are typically repaired? Repairs usually involve standard ceiling fans used in retail, office, or warehouse spaces, including those with multiple blades and variable speed controls.
Is it necessary to replace a damaged ceiling fan instead of repairing it? Repair is often a practical option for minor issues, but replacement may be considered if the fan is outdated or has extensive damage.
